Comprehensive Introduction to HCG Beta Total Testing

The HCG Beta Total Quantitative Tumor Marker Test represents a sophisticated diagnostic approach in modern oncology. This specialized blood test measures the beta subunit of human chorionic gonadotropin (HCG), a hormone that serves as a critical biomarker for several types of cancer. While HCG is naturally produced during pregnancy, elevated levels in non-pregnant individuals can indicate the presence of malignant tumors, making this test an essential tool for cancer detection, monitoring, and management.

What Does the HCG Beta Total Test Measure?

This advanced diagnostic test specifically quantifies the beta subunit of human chorionic gonadotropin using Chemiluminescent Microparticle Immunoassay technology. The test detects:

  • Abnormal HCG beta levels indicating testicular germ cell tumors
  • Elevated markers for ovarian cancer detection
  • Gestational trophoblastic disease markers
  • Recurrence monitoring for previously treated cancers
  • Treatment response assessment in oncology patients

Understanding Your Test Results

Interpreting HCG Beta Total results requires professional medical guidance:

  • Normal Range: Typically indicates no active tumor presence
  • Elevated Levels: May suggest tumor activity requiring further investigation
  • Trend Analysis: Serial testing helps monitor treatment progress
  • Clinical Correlation: Results are interpreted alongside symptoms and imaging
  • Follow-up Protocol: Abnormal results typically require additional testing

Sample Requirements and Processing

The test requires 2 mL (1 mL minimum) serum collected from one SST tube. Samples are shipped refrigerated or frozen to maintain integrity. No special patient preparation is needed, making the testing process straightforward and convenient.
